not to go too far off topic, but i think any dressing, as long as u keep going over the dressed area with the same applicator until it absorbs the excess, will look satin and rich.

i have found that to be true. the ardex tire dressing we use at work is called ice blue. when i spray it on, it dries very shiny, but if i aplly with an applicator it is more a flat shine. i hope this helps any.

i always apply with an applicator. but if i keep passing the same applictor over the sidewall it gives a very even sheen, and the foam just absorbs the excess.
